Core模块主要的功能是实现了控制反转与依赖注入、Bean配置以及加载。Core模块中有Beans、BeanFactory、BeanDefinitions、ApplicationContext等概念
BeanFactory
BeanFactory是实例化、配置、管理众多bean的容器
在Web程序中用户不需要实例化Beanfactory,Web程序加载的时候会自动实例化BeanFactory...
分类:
编程语言 时间:
2015-03-05 09:15:26
阅读次数:
217
1、所有的类都可以交给Spring管理2、如何把一个类交给bean管理?(1)配置applicationContext.xml(2)在xml中写入bean节点配置要交给bean管理的类3、程序测试(1)导入spring core container的jar包,spring核心包含以下包:(2)新建a...
分类:
编程语言 时间:
2015-03-04 18:42:15
阅读次数:
147
5.4.1 xml风格的配置 SpEL支持在Bean定义时注入,默认使用“#{SpEL表达式}”表示,其中“#root”根对象默认可以认为是 ApplicationContext,只有ApplicationContext实现默认支持SpEL,获取根对象属性其实是获取容器中的Bean。 首先看下配置方...
分类:
编程语言 时间:
2015-03-04 16:24:33
阅读次数:
171
applicationcontext-quartz.xml 代码: work ...
分类:
其他好文 时间:
2015-03-02 13:02:32
阅读次数:
172
方式1:ApplicationContext ac = (ApplicationContext) invocation.getInvocationContext().getApplication().get(WebApplicationContext.ROOT_WEB_APPLICATION_CON...
分类:
移动开发 时间:
2015-03-02 11:05:23
阅读次数:
156
这里发现时由于代码里手动加载 ApplicationContext.xml文件造成的;问题代码:ApplicationContext context = new ClassPathXmlApplicationContext("applicationContext-*.xml");IXXXServic...
分类:
其他好文 时间:
2015-02-28 18:21:59
阅读次数:
122
一、ApplicationContextAware接口 当一个类需要获取ApplicationContext实例时,可以让该类实现ApplicationContextAware接口。代码展示如下:public class Animal implements ApplicationContextAwa...
分类:
编程语言 时间:
2015-02-28 13:00:16
阅读次数:
161
1、新建一个java工程2、添加spring相关的jar包并添加到引用3、添加spring依赖的相关jar包并添加到引用4、编写spring配置文件applicationcontext.xml新建applicationContext.xml文件,然后编写头文件。关于spring头文件的写法可以参考s...
分类:
编程语言 时间:
2015-02-27 21:25:37
阅读次数:
170
先从persistence.xml开始:org.hibernate.ejb.HibernatePersistence –>org.hibernate.ejb.HibernatePersistence –> –>这里定义两个: 注意name值区分。2.applicationContext.xml:注意...
分类:
编程语言 时间:
2015-02-18 00:52:18
阅读次数:
295
一,在使用Spring系列框架时,我们需要在Web.xml配置Spring的监听:ContextLoaderListener ContextLoaderListener的作用就是,在Web容器初始化时自动加载所对应的applicationContext.xml等配置文件,以帮助Spring完成其他....
分类:
编程语言 时间:
2015-02-12 22:42:20
阅读次数:
180